Making peace with political class: The story behind the consensus over Lokpal Bill

The passage of the Lokpal Bill showed a rare unanimity between the political class and Anna's team.

Hours after Rahul Gandhi had come out in support of the Lokpal Bill at Congress headquarters last Saturday,chairman of the Rajya Sabha select committee Satyavrat Chaturvedi got a call from Kiran Bedi in Ralegaon Siddhi. She expressed her appreciation for his committees efforts and passed on the phone to Anna Hazare,who too praised the panels recommendations.

It was a different Anna Hazare from the one who had attacked the government two years ago after the Parliamentary Standing Committee decision to keep the lower bureaucracy out of the Lokpals purview. He Rahul must have pressured the committee to keep the lower bureaucracy out, Hazare had said. Chaturvedi had reacted,His Hazares word is not Lord Brahmas. Is he Satyawadi Harishchandra?
